By the end of my presentation, I’d like for you to know…, I aim to prove to you / change your mind about…, I’d like to take this opportunity to talk about…, As you know, this morning/afternoon I’ll be discussing…, First, I’m going to present… Then I’ll share with you… Finally, I’ll ask you to…, Today I will be covering these 3 (or 5) key points…, In this presentation, we will discuss/evaluate…, By the end of this presentation, you’ll be able to…, My talk this morning is divided into [number] main sections… First, second, third… Finally…. Welcome your audience and introduce yourself, Identify your number one goal or topic of presentation, Give a quick outline of your presentation, Provide instructions for how to ask questions (if appropriate for your situation).
